Product Brief Introduction
DS200UCPBG6AFB is the core CPU processing motherboard for GE Mark V distributed gas/steam turbine control DCS system, responsible for real-time turbine operating parameter acquisition, control algorithm operation, safety interlock logic judgment and system communication data forwarding. It is a critical safety-grade control board applied in power generation heavy-duty turbine units, with triple redundant signal processing capability to meet power plant safety operation standards.

Core Technical Specifications
- Processing Performance Parameters
- Core Processor: 32-bit industrial PowerPC real-time CPU, 667 MHz fixed operating frequency
- On-board Memory: 1 GB ECC error correction DDR3 RAM, 512 MB NAND Flash program storage
- External Storage Expansion: Max 32 GB industrial SD card for operation log and control program backup
- Control Cycle Range: 1 ms ~ 1000 ms adjustable core control loop cycle, default 1 ms fast turbine regulation cycle
- Maximum Control Loop Capacity: Supports over 1000 independent analog and digital control loops simultaneously
- Rotational Speed Control Precision: Turbine speed steady-state fluctuation ≤ ±0.1% rated nominal speed
- Electrical & Environmental Parameters
- Rated Power Supply: 28 VDC input, wide voltage operating range 18 VDC ~ 32 VDC
- Operating Temperature: -40°C ~ +70°C industrial wide temperature range
- MTBF Reliability Index: Over 200,000 hours average fault-free operation
- Safety Certification: IEC 61508 SIL 2 safety integrity level certified
- Vibration Resistance: 0–100 Hz, 5 g continuous vibration tolerance for power plant cabinet environment
- Mechanical Dimension & Weight
- Standard Rack Board Size: 168 mm × 150 mm × 55 mm
- Net Weight: 1327 g including onboard heat sink and integrated components
Function Features
- Working Principle: Multi-channel analog/digital signal front-end conditioning circuit collects turbine vibration, temperature, pressure, rotational speed sensor signals; PowerPC CPU executes GE dedicated turbine control language (TCL) and IEC 61131-3 standard control logic, outputs regulating signals to actuator I/O boards via backplane bus; triple redundant signal comparison circuit judges signal validity to avoid single point sensor failure triggering unit trip
- Onboard 7-position DIP configuration switch block for system address, communication baud rate and safety interlock mode setting
- Integrated multi-channel Ethernet communication interface for HMI operator station and redundant controller data synchronization
- Built-in hardware watchdog circuit; automatic board reset and fault record storage when CPU operation stall occurs
- Full ECC memory error correction function, automatically correcting single-bit data storage errors without system shutdown
- 34-pin ribbon cable daughter board expansion interface for auxiliary signal processing sub-board connection
- Comprehensive onboard fault diagnostic circuit, storing historical fault codes into non-volatile flash memory for post-failure troubleshooting
Material Composition
- PCB Baseboard: Thick copper multi-layer industrial control PCB with high-temperature resistant solder mask
- Main Heat Sink: Black anodized aluminum extruded heat sink for CPU chip heat dissipation
- Connector Hardware: Gold-plated high-current backplane edge connectors and 34-pin ribbon cable plug terminals
- Passive Components: Industrial wide-temperature tantalum capacitors and metal film precision resistors with long service life
- Protective Coating: Conformal acrylic insulation coating on entire PCB surface to resist dust, moisture and corrosive gas in power plant cabinets
Structural Characteristics
- Standard vertical rack plug-in board design, compatible with GE Mark V system 19-inch control cabinet rack slots
- Central large aluminum heat sink mounted above main CPU chip for passive heat dissipation
- Left side multi-channel signal terminal connectors for external sensor wiring access
- Right side long gold-plated edge connector for system backplane power and bus communication connection
- Front panel small DIP switch window for manual system configuration without disassembly
- Four corner insulated standoff mounting points for fixing daughter board expansion modules

Installation Requirements
- Insert vertically into Mark V rack slot, fully engage backplane edge connector with locking screw tightened to fixed torque
- Reserve 30 mm vertical gap between adjacent rack boards for cabinet air cooling airflow circulation
- Before disassembly, record all DIP switch positions with label or photo to restore original configuration after replacement
- Connect 34-pin ribbon cable strictly matching original wiring pin sequence, avoid reverse insertion
- Cabinet internal cooling fan must maintain continuous operation; board surface temperature cannot exceed 70°C
- Equipotential grounding busbar connected to rack frame to eliminate power grid common-mode interference
Operation & Maintenance Precautions
- All maintenance operations must execute unit partial shutdown safety procedure, cut off rack 28 VDC power supply before board removal
- Wear anti-static wrist strap during disassembly and replacement; static discharge will damage onboard CPU and memory chips
- Do not wipe PCB conformal coating surface with organic solvent; only use dry anti-static brush to clean dust
- After replacement, download backup control program from SD card and verify all interlock logic before unit restart
- Regularly export fault log data every 3 months to predict component aging failure risk
- If over-temperature alarm occurs, check cabinet fan operation and heat sink dust accumulation blockage
